Academic Forgiveness

Undergraduate students who have a break in enrollment from UNC Charlotte for a minimum period of 24 consecutive months or undergraduate students who have a break in enrollment from Charlotte for a minimum of one (1) regular semester and earn an Associate of Arts (AA), an Associate of Science (AS), an Associate of Fine Arts (AFA) or an Associate of Engineering (AE) degree are eligible for readmission with forgiveness.

  • Students may be readmitted one time only under this policy, and the forgiveness policy will be applied automatically upon readmission if the student is eligible. 
  • Students electing not to apply the forgiveness policy may request to waive the policy in its entirety at the time of readmission only.   
  • If a student is readmitted with forgiveness, only those courses for which the student has received a grade of C or above (or H or P) can be used for academic credit. 
  • Readmission under the forgiveness policy also resets the student’s W-limit hours (see UNC Charlotte Academic Policy: Withdrawal and Cancellation of Enrollment) to the full 16 hours.
  • The GPA will be based only on the courses that return with the student and the courses taken after readmission.
  • Eligibility for continued enrollment is determined as in the case of transfer students.
  • To qualify for graduation with honors, a readmitted student must have a GPA computed on at least 48 hours taken in residence on which the UNC Charlotte GPA is based. 

SECOND BACCALAUREATE MAJOR/ BACCALAUREATE MINOR

Students who have earned a bachelor’s degree from UNC Charlotte may apply for readmission into a program leading to a second major, minor or second degree (see UNC Charlotte Academic Policy: Declaring Undergraduate Majors and Minors). Students readmitted for a second degree are not eligible for application of the forgiveness policy toward the first degree.
